Aconitine is synthesized via the aconitum plant by way of terpenoid biosynthesis from methylerythritol phosphate pathway that polymerizes subsequent to phosphorylation.
The arrhythmogenic Houses of aconitine are partly because of its cholinolytic (anticholinergic) outcomes mediated through the vagus nerve. Aconitine features a constructive inotropic outcome by prolonging sodium inflow during the action prospective. It's got hypotensive and bradycardic steps resulting from activation with the ventromedial nucleus in the hypothalamus. Through its motion on voltage-delicate sodium channels from the axons, aconitine blocks neuromuscular transmission by reducing the evoked quantal launch of acetylcholine. Aconitine, can induce sturdy contractions in the ileum by way of acetylcholine launch within the postganglionic cholinergic nerves.
The cardiotoxicity and neurotoxicity of aconitine and linked alkaloids are because of their actions within the voltage-delicate sodium channels from the mobile membranes of excitable tissues, such as the myocardium, nerves, and muscles. As previously explained, aconitine binds with superior affinity on the open up point out in the voltage-delicate sodium channels at web page 2, thereby triggering a persistent activation with the sodium channels, which turn out to be refractory to excitation. The electrophysiological mechanism of arrhythmia induction is induced action as a consequence of delayed right after-depolarization and early immediately after-depolarization.

Aconite's alkaloids Use a slim therapeutic index as well as the alkaloid variety and amount of money vary with species, location of harvest, and adequacy of processing. Processing could decrease alkaloid content material and/or aconitine change alkaloid composition, Therefore lessening potency; on the other hand, poisoning may still come about once the consumption of processed aconite root.
Marked indicators look in a few minutes of the administration of a toxic dose of aconite. The First indications are gastrointestinal. There's a feeling of burning, tingling, and numbness from the mouth, and of burning from the abdomen. Normally Loss of life ensues before a numbing effect on the intestine can be observed.
